MINUTES — Management Meeting, Orlane Digital
Present: Heads of department; chair, M. Strettle

1. Approved migration of all Wrenfold platform customers to annual billing from next fiscal year.
2. Monthly billing retired except for trial accounts.
3. Finance to model refund exposure; report due in two weeks.
4. Customer comms drafted by marketing, reviewed by legal.
5. Department heads to flag operational impacts by month-end.

The confidential business note follows below these minutes.

board note of kageg-bahof: The renewal with Holwynax Holdings closes at $2 million a year, 5 percent below the last contract. Project Ulaath slips by two quarters because of the supplier delay.

14:22 — Offline sync regression confirmed (Terrapath field-survey app)

At 14:22 the on-call engineer reproduced the data-loss path: surveys saved while offline were marked synced once connectivity returned, even when the upload was rejected. The queue flush skipped the server acknowledgement check introduced in the previous sprint. Release manager note: the fix must ship before the coastal survey season. The offending build is identified by the token recorded below.

session token of kawif-fawig = htk31_f3f599be2b1a34affb1efa8d0feccf8

Facilities ticket — Halewick Tower, night shift.

Issue: support team reporting east stairwell reader rejecting badges after midnight. Reader was reset this morning; firmware updated. Overnight crew should now badge as normal. If the reader fails again, use the manual keypad by the fire door — do not prop the door. Log any further failures with the time and badge name. Temporary keypad code for the fallback door is below.

door code, tajeg-fawip: bdg-K-62

**Ticket: PickPath optimizer dropping connections mid-batch**

The Fennwick warehouse pick-list optimizer intermittently loses its database connection during the 02:00 route recalculation, leaving partially written pick sequences. We suspect pool exhaustion when the batch exceeds roughly 4,000 lines. Future maintainers should verify pool sizing and statement timeouts before re-running. For reproduction, point a staging worker at the affected replica using the connection string provided below.

replica DSN, kajep-yahag: mssql://praok_svc:iF@db-8d68.plorvaio.local:5432/eliion